Abstract

Official abstract text for this publication.

The present invention provides a stitched reinforcing-fiber base material comprising a reinforcing-fiber base material composed of reinforcing fiber and a stitching thread comprising polyethersulfone fiber, the stitched reinforcing-fiber base material being characterized in that the reinforcing-fiber base material is stitched with the stitching thread.

First claim

Opening claim text (preview).

1 . A stitched reinforcing-fiber base material comprising: a reinforcing-fiber base material composed of reinforcing fibers; and a stitching thread including a polyethersulfone fiber, wherein the reinforcing-fiber base material is stitched with the stitching thread. 2 . The stitched reinforcing-fiber base material according to claim 1 , wherein the reinforcing-fiber base material is a reinforcing-fiber base material composed of a reinforcing-fiber sheet composed of reinforcing fibers aligned in uni-direction. 3 . The stitched reinforcing-fiber base material according to claim 2 , wherein the reinforcing-fiber base material is a multiaxial base material formed by laminating a plurality of the reinforcing-fiber sheets while mutually changing angles of fiber axes. 4 . The stitched reinforcing-fiber base material according to claim 1 , wherein the reinforcing-fiber base material is a reinforcing-fiber base material formed by placed a resin material on a surface of the reinforcing-fiber base material and/or between layers composed of reinforcing fibers. 5 . The stitched reinforcing-fiber base material according to claim 1 , wherein a single yarn fineness of the stitching thread is 1 to 10 dtex/filament. 6 . The stitched reinforcing-fiber base material according to claim 1 , wherein a total fineness of the stitching thread is 1 to 250 dtex. 7 . The stitched reinforcing-fiber base material according to claim 1 , wherein the number of filaments of the stitching thread is 1 to 60. 8 . The stitched reinforcing-fiber base material according to claim 1 , wherein the polyethersulfone fiber is a polyethersulfone fiber composed of polyethersulfone having a glass transition point of 160 to 250° C. 9 . The stitched reinforcing-fiber base material according to claim 1 , wherein a content ratio of the stitching thread is 0.1 to 30 mass % with respect to a mass of the stitched reinforcing-fiber base material. 10 . A method for producing the stitched reinforcing-fiber base material according to claim 1 , the method comprising stitching a reinforcing-fiber base material composed of reinforcing fibers with a stitching thread including a polyethersulfone fiber. 11 . A preform material comprising: the stitched reinforcing-fiber base material according to claim 1 ; and 1 to 20 parts by mass of a binder resin with respect to 100 parts by mass of the stitched reinforcing-fiber base material. 12 . A method for producing a preform material, the method comprising heating, under pressure, the stitched reinforcing-fiber base material according to claim 1 and 1 to 20 parts by mass of a binder resin with respect to 100 parts by mass of the stitched reinforcing-fiber base material. 13 . A fiber-reinforced composite material comprising: the stitched reinforcing-fiber base material according to claim 1 ; and a matrix resin impregnated into the stitched reinforcing-fiber base material. 14 . A method for producing a fiber-reinforced composite material, the method comprising impregnating a matrix resin into the stitched reinforcing-fiber base material according to claim 1 . 15 . A method for producing a fiber-reinforced composite material, the method comprising impregnating a matrix resin into the preform material according to claim 11 .
